Pentecostals believe in the resurrection of the dead and that those who have accepted Jesus Christ as their savior will go to heaven, while those who have not will face eternal separation from God in hell. They believe in the existence of heaven and hell as literal places where souls go after death based on their faith and actions in life.

Baptists do go to movies. There is nothing in the Baptist doctrine that forbids going to movies, or watching TV, either. The only religion that I know of that does not go to movies is the Pentecostal faith. Many of the older Pentecostals, and those of the more devout faith don't even believe in having television, either.
